Ticket: Door sensor recall — Lobby B, Pellworth Annex

Heads up, the swing-door sensors are part of the Lumetra recall, so they're being swapped out Thursday morning. Expect a bit of beeping and prop the cones out if needed. The installers will need letting through the side entrance, which takes the code below.

badge for fafop-fajof: bdg-Z-47

Handing off to you, Priya — the read-replica lag alarm on Copperquill has been flapping all afternoon. It's mostly the nightly batch import pushing lag past 40s; real incidents look different (lag climbs steadily, doesn't recover). If you need to silence it properly or restart the replica agent, you'll need the ops vault open first. To unlock it, use the passphrase below.

recovery phrase for fawif-tajeg: norael-aldmir-casir-brivan-ulaion

Facilities Ticket — Cleaning Crew Access, Brindle Annex

For new starters handling evening lock-up: the Sorano Cleaning crew arrives nightly at 21:30 via the annex side door. Check their rota sheet, note arrival in the log, and ensure the storeroom is relocked afterward. To let them through the side door, enter the access code below.

badge for yaweg-hafog: bdg-GX-6

Leadership Review Briefing — The "Summit" Tier

Quick one before Thursday's session. We're proposing a premium tier for Fernhollow, pitched above Plus, bundling priority support, the analytics pack, and early feature access. Early panel feedback was warm, though pricing sensitivity kicked in hard above the tested ceiling. We'd pilot with roughly two hundred accounts in the Orvale region first, then decide on a wider launch. Margin modelling looks workable but not generous. The commercial assumptions behind this are summarised immediately below.

confidential, kagup-bafog: Fraaxax Group is in early talks to buy Soroxox Group for about $343.8 million. The Olidor launch date is June 14, and nothing goes to the press before then. Legal wants the Aldmirek Logistics term sheet signed before July 23.